Server Error, Fix?

Lixsady

Member
Code:
21:48:47 [ERROR] An error occurred whilst handling LoginPacket for Lixsady
org.iq80.leveldb.impl.DbImpl$BackgroundProcessingException: com.google.common.util.concurrent.UncheckedExecutionException: java.lang.RuntimeException: java.io.FileNotFoundException: C:\Users\cspan\OneDrive\Desktop\NukkitX - Copy\players\000127.ldb (The system cannot find the file specified)
        at org.iq80.leveldb.impl.DbImpl.checkBackgroundException(DbImpl.java:366)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.DbImpl.writeInternal(DbImpl.java:624)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.DbImpl.put(DbImpl.java:595)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.DbImpl.put(DbImpl.java:589)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at cn.nukkit.Server.updateName(Server.java:1602)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at cn.nukkit.Player.processLogin(Player.java:1914)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at cn.nukkit.Player.handleDataPacket(Player.java:2250)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at cn.nukkit.network.RakNetInterface.process(RakNetInterface.java:123) [nukkit-1.0-SNAPSHOT.jar:?]
        at cn.nukkit.network.Network.processInterfaces(Network.java:165) [nukkit-1.0-SNAPSHOT.jar:?]
        at cn.nukkit.Server.tick(Server.java:1164) [nukkit-1.0-SNAPSHOT.jar:?]
        at cn.nukkit.Server.tickProcessor(Server.java:940) [nukkit-1.0-SNAPSHOT.jar:?]
        at cn.nukkit.Server.start(Server.java:908) [nukkit-1.0-SNAPSHOT.jar:?]
        at cn.nukkit.Server.<init>(Server.java:589) [nukkit-1.0-SNAPSHOT.jar:?]
        at cn.nukkit.Nukkit.main(Nukkit.java:120) [nukkit-1.0-SNAPSHOT.jar:?]
Caused by: com.google.common.util.concurrent.UncheckedExecutionException: java.lang.RuntimeException: java.io.FileNotFoundException: C:\Users\cspan\OneDrive\Desktop\NukkitX - Copy\players\000127.ldb (The system cannot find the file specified)
        at com.google.common.cache.LocalCache$Segment.get(LocalCache.java:2217)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at com.google.common.cache.LocalCache.get(LocalCache.java:4154)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at com.google.common.cache.LocalCache.getOrLoad(LocalCache.java:4158)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at com.google.common.cache.LocalCache$LocalLoadingCache.get(LocalCache.java:5147)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.TableCache.getTable(TableCache.java:77)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.TableCache.newIterator(TableCache.java:67)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.TableCache.newIterator(TableCache.java:63)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.util.Level0Iterator.<init>(Level0Iterator.java:42)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.VersionSet.makeInputIterator(VersionSet.java:199)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.DbImpl.doCompactionWork(DbImpl.java:948)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.DbImpl.backgroundCompaction(DbImpl.java:427)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.DbImpl.backgroundCall(DbImpl.java:380)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.DbImpl.access$100(DbImpl.java:57)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.DbImpl$2.call(DbImpl.java:352)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.DbImpl$2.call(DbImpl.java:347)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at java.util.concurrent.FutureTask.run(FutureTask.java:264) ~[?:?]
        at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1136) ~[?:?]
        at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:635) ~[?:?]
        at java.lang.Thread.run(Thread.java:833) ~[?:?]
Caused by: java.lang.RuntimeException: java.io.FileNotFoundException: C:\Users\cspan\OneDrive\Desktop\NukkitX - Copy\players\000127.ldb (The system cannot find the file specified)
        at org.iq80.leveldb.impl.TableCache.lambda$new$1(TableCache.java:57)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at com.google.common.cache.CacheLoader$FunctionToCacheLoader.load(CacheLoader.java:146)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at com.google.common.cache.LocalCache$LoadingValueReference.loadFuture(LocalCache.java:3716)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at com.google.common.cache.LocalCache$Segment.loadSync(LocalCache.java:2424)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at com.google.common.cache.LocalCache$Segment.lockedGetOrLoad(LocalCache.java:2298)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at com.google.common.cache.LocalCache$Segment.get(LocalCache.java:2211)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at com.google.common.cache.LocalCache.get(LocalCache.java:4154)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at com.google.common.cache.LocalCache.getOrLoad(LocalCache.java:4158)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at com.google.common.cache.LocalCache$LocalLoadingCache.get(LocalCache.java:5147)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.TableCache.getTable(TableCache.java:77)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.TableCache.newIterator(TableCache.java:67)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.TableCache.newIterator(TableCache.java:63)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.util.Level0Iterator.<init>(Level0Iterator.java:42)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.VersionSet.makeInputIterator(VersionSet.java:199)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.DbImpl.doCompactionWork(DbImpl.java:948)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.DbImpl.backgroundCompaction(DbImpl.java:427)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.DbImpl.backgroundCall(DbImpl.java:380)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.DbImpl.access$100(DbImpl.java:57)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.DbImpl$2.call(DbImpl.java:352)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.DbImpl$2.call(DbImpl.java:347)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at java.util.concurrent.FutureTask.run(FutureTask.java:264) ~[?:?]
        at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1136) ~[?:?]
        at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:635) ~[?:?]
        at java.lang.Thread.run(Thread.java:833) ~[?:?]
Caused by: java.io.FileNotFoundException: C:\Users\cspan\OneDrive\Desktop\NukkitX - Copy\players\000127.ldb (The system cannot find the file specified)
        at java.io.FileInputStream.open0(Native Method) ~[?:?]
        at java.io.FileInputStream.open(FileInputStream.java:216) ~[?:?]
        at java.io.FileInputStream.<init>(FileInputStream.java:157) ~[?:?]
        at org.iq80.leveldb.impl.TableCache$TableAndFile.<init>(TableCache.java:110)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.TableCache$TableAndFile.<init>(TableCache.java:103)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.TableCache.lambda$new$1(TableCache.java:55)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at com.google.common.cache.CacheLoader$FunctionToCacheLoader.load(CacheLoader.java:146)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at com.google.common.cache.LocalCache$LoadingValueReference.loadFuture(LocalCache.java:3716)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at com.google.common.cache.LocalCache$Segment.loadSync(LocalCache.java:2424)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at com.google.common.cache.LocalCache$Segment.lockedGetOrLoad(LocalCache.java:2298)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at com.google.common.cache.LocalCache$Segment.get(LocalCache.java:2211)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at com.google.common.cache.LocalCache.get(LocalCache.java:4154)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at com.google.common.cache.LocalCache.getOrLoad(LocalCache.java:4158)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at com.google.common.cache.LocalCache$LocalLoadingCache.get(LocalCache.java:5147)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.TableCache.getTable(TableCache.java:77)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.TableCache.newIterator(TableCache.java:67)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.TableCache.newIterator(TableCache.java:63)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.util.Level0Iterator.<init>(Level0Iterator.java:42)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.VersionSet.makeInputIterator(VersionSet.java:199)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.DbImpl.doCompactionWork(DbImpl.java:948)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.DbImpl.backgroundCompaction(DbImpl.java:427)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.DbImpl.backgroundCall(DbImpl.java:380)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.DbImpl.access$100(DbImpl.java:57)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.DbImpl$2.call(DbImpl.java:352)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at org.iq80.leveldb.impl.DbImpl$2.call(DbImpl.java:347) ~[nukkit-1.0-SNAPSHOT.jar:?]
        at java.util.concurrent.FutureTask.run(FutureTask.java:264) ~[?:?]
        at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1136) ~[?:?]
        at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:635) ~[?:?]
        at java.lang.Thread.run(Thread.java:833) ~[?:?]
when someone try's to login to the server the server will throw this error and the user will be stuck on the locating server screen
 
Last edited:

SupremeMortal

Administrator
Staff member
It would appear that your player data has been corrupted. Did you delete any files in your players/ directory in the server?
 
Top